Rogue & Umpqua Valleys at a Glance
Rafting, kayaking, hiking and fishing are just some of the activities that keep
visitors coming back to the Rogue and Umpqua Valleys in southwestern Oregon.
Roseburg is the base for many
area tour companies and guide services, and it is also a good destination for
lodging that is near to several of the Valley's wineries. Annual events showcasing
the area's wines are a major draw for visitors who are seeking to sample some
of Oregon's award winning grapes. While the Umpqua Valley is well-known for the
wineries that dot the rolling hills in this part of the state, the exceptional
fly fishing that is available on the North Umpqua River is another popular activity.
For those feeling lucky, the Seven
Feathers Casino in Canyonville
offers slots, gaming tables and refreshments. If hitting the links is an interest,
golf can be enjoyed in nearby Myrtle
Creek, just one more example of this area's abundant outdoor recreational
activities.
